Persipura Jayapura sack Peter Butler despite positive results

Despite currently staying in the top five on the league table, Persipura Jayapura are reportedly not satisfied with Peter Butler works. The English coach was sacked on 22 June following a board meeting to evaluate the Mutiara Hitam results in Go-Jek Liga 1 2018.

“We decide to not continue the partnership with Peter Butler, and we thank him for the works in recent months. Especially for the chances that has been given to Papua young players”, said Persipura General Manager, Benhur Tommy Mano, who also the Mayor of Jayapura city.

The dismissal raised many eyebrows as Persipura were having a good run earlier this season. The club has won five games, draw two and lost two . The Jayapura side are consistently staying at the top of the table for 8 weeks, started from 3rd match until the 10th match.

But in last 4 games, Persipura are winless. They lost against Persija Jakarta and Bali United, then draw against Persebaya Surabaya and PSM Makassar. Three of them (except Persebaya) are the title contenders in Go-Jek Liga 1 2018, and that was only one match played at home (Mandala Stadium) while the rests are away games.

For a while, Persipura will be coached by Tony Ho and Alan Haviludin. Tony was the assistant coach of Peter Butler, and Alan is a goalkeeper coach. The new management team will lead Persipura at home against the title-holder, Bhayangkara FC, at Matchday 14, following the Eid Mubarak break.
